Closed shrubland — Emissions in Democratic Republic of the Congo
Democratic Republic of the Congo: Closed shrubland — Emissions was 0.0044 kt in 2024. ◆ Volatile
Closed shrubland — Emissions in Democratic Republic of the Congo, 1990–2024
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Democratic Republic of the Congo recorded 0.0044 kt for closed shrubland — emissions in 2024.
Compared with earlier readings it is up 238.5% on the previous year and up 2,100.0% over ten years.
Over the whole period, closed shrubland — emissions in Democratic Republic of the Congo peaked at 0.2485 kt in 1999 and was at its lowest, 0.0002 kt, in 2014.
Democratic Republic of the Congo ranks 3rd of 21 countries on this measure, in the top 10%.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ions from Fires consists of estimates of methane (CH4), nitrous oxide (N2O) and carbon dioxide (CO2) emissions generated from biomass burning in a range of vegetation types and from fires in organic soils.
